@charset "utf-8";
/* CSS Document */

#leftSideBar02			{float:left; width:511px;margin:0 2px 5px 5px; display:inline;}
#rightSideBar02			{float:right; width:401px; margin:0 5px 5px 0; display:inline;}
#leftSideBar03			{float:left; width:195px; margin:0 0 5px 8px;}
#rightSideBar03		{float:right; width:700px; margin:0 10px 5px 0;}

.leftcont01               {float:left; width:500px;}
.rightcont01               {float:right; width:217px;}


.prof               {background:url(../images/bg_img.gif) repeat-x; height:52px; padding:6px 3px;}
a.work              {}
a.edit              {font-weight:bold; color:#003399;}
.inpT               {border:1px solid #000;} 
.inBOX              {background:#e0e0e0;} 
.select             {background:url(../images/bggray_grd.gif) repeat-x; /*padding:0 0 35px 10px;*/ height:46px;}
.select1             {background:url(../images/bggray_grd.gif) repeat-x; /*padding:0 0 35px 10px;*/ height:4px;}
.list               {overflow:auto; height:175px; margin-top:15px;;}  
             
.drop               {width:220px;}

h2.one  {color:#000; font:bold 12px verdana; padding:10px 0 5px 10px;}
h2.two   {color:#000; font:bold 14px verdana; padding-bottom:5px; border-bottom:1px solid #666;}



ul.usrnm01  {margin:0; width:450px; float:left;}
ul.usrnm01 li		{list-style-type:none; clear:both; padding:3px}
ul.usrnm01 li label  {float:left; width:200px; margin-top:7px; font-weight:bold; text-align:right;}
ul.usrnm01 li input  {float:left; margin:5px; padding:3px;border:1px solid #bdbdbd;font-size:11px;}
ul.usrnm01 li textarea  {float:left; margin:5px; padding:3px;border:1px solid #bdbdbd;font-size:11px;}
ul.usrnm01 li select  {float:left; margin:5px; padding:3px;border:1px solid #bdbdbd;font-size:11px;}
.selectbox			{float:left; margin:5px; padding:3px;border:1px solid #bdbdbd;font-size:11px;}
.selectboxnomargin			{float:left; padding:3px;border:1px solid #bdbdbd;font-size:11px;}
.selectbox1			{float:left; margin:5px; padding:3px;border:1px solid #bdbdbd;font-size:12px;}
.mselectbox			{float:left;border:1px solid #bdbdbd;font-size:12px; width:200px; height:100px;}
li .tip				{padding:0px 3px 3px 155px; color:#a6a5a5; float:left;}




ul.login               {list-style:none; margin:0; color:#5b5b5b;}
ul.login li             {display:block;background:url(../images/arrow.gif) no-repeat 20px 18px; /*height:32px;*/ margin:8px 0pt 11px 10px;padding:8px 10px 8px 5px;}
ul.login a             {font:normal 12px Arial; color:#5b5b5b; padding-left:45px; text-decoration:none; display:block;}
ul.login span             {padding:20px 0 20px 45px;}
ul.login a:hover        {text-decoration:underline;}

.searchTL,.searchTR,.searchBL,.searchBR   {background:url(../images/rounded_img.gif) no-repeat; overflow:hidden;}
.searchTL                {background-position:left top; height:4px;}
.searchTR                {background-position:right top;}
.searchBL                {background-position:0% -13px; height:4px}
.searchBR                {background-position:100% -13px; height:4p}
.brdLR                    {border-left:1px solid #a7a4a4; border-right:1px solid #a7a4a4;}


ul.message					{margin:10px auto; padding-bottom:15px;}
ul.message li 				{float:left; margin-bottom:10px; clear:both; display:inline;}
ul.message li img			{float:left; margin-right:7px;}
ul.message li a				{background:none; color:#003399; font:normal 11px verdana !important; display:inline;}
ul.message li a span	    {color:#929195; font-size:13px; text-decoration:underline;}

ul.image       {background:#e0e0e0; width:100%}
ul.image li    {margin-left:10px; padding:0; list-style-type:none; display:inline;}
ul.image li a  {background:url(../images/btnbg.png) no-repeat left top; padding-left:8px; display:block; font-size:12px; color:#000;}
ul.image li a span {background:url(../images/btnbg.png) no-repeat right -35px; padding:8px 17px 8px 10px; display:block; color:#000;}
ul.image li a:hover {text-decoration:none; color:#4ab7d2;}

#menuTwo		{background:#e0e0e0; width:100%} 	
#menuTwo ul	 	{margin-left:10px; padding:0; list-style-type:none;}
#menuTwo li 	{display:inline; float:left; margin-right:5px}
#menuTwo a 		{float: left; padding-left:8px; background:url(../images/tab.gif) no-repeat right top; display:block;}
#menuTwo a span {background:transparent url(../images/lftTab.gif) no-repeat left top; padding:5px 20px 5px 11px;color:#767676;
display:block; float:left; cursor:pointer; /* IE doesnt display the hand when you roll over the link for some reason. This fixes it */}



/*#submenu ul		  {margin-left:10px; padding:0px; list-style-type:none; background:#e0e0e0;}
#submenu ul li      {display:inline; float:left; margin-right:5px; padding:0px;}
#submenu ul li a	   {padding-left:8px;background:url(../images/tab.gif) no-repeat 0% 0%; display:block;}
#submenu ul li a span	{padding:5px 20px 5px 12px;background:url(../images/tab.gif) no-repeat 100% 0%; display:block; cursor:pointer;}
#submenu li a:hover 	{padding-left:8px;background:url(../images/tab.gif) no-repeat 0% -25px; display:block;}
#submenu ul li a:hover span	{padding:5px 20px 5px 12px;background:url(../images/tab.gif) no-repeat 100% -25px; display:block;}
#submenu ul li a.active 	{padding-left:8px;background:url(../images/tab.gif) no-repeat 0% -25px; display:block;color:#767676;}
#submenu ul li a.active span	{padding:5px 20px 5px 12px;background:url(../images/tab.gif) no-repeat 100% -25px; display:block;}*/

#submenu ul		  {margin-left:10px; padding:0px; list-style-type:none; background:#e0e0e0;}
#submenu ul li      {display:inline; float:left; padding:0px;}
#submenu ul li a	   {padding-left:4px; display:block;color:#666666;}
#submenu ul li a span	{padding:4px 10px 4px 6px;background:url(../images/grey_gradi.gif) repeat-x 100% 0%; display:block; cursor:pointer; border:solid 1px #969696;}
#submenu li a:hover 	{display:block;border-bottom:solid 1px #fff;}
#submenu ul li a:hover span	{padding:6px 10px 5px 6px;background:#fff; display:block;border-bottom:solid 1px #fff;}
#submenu ul li a.active 	{padding-left:4px;display:block;color:#3399cc; border-bottom:solid 1px #fff;}
#submenu ul li a.active span	{padding:6px 10px 5px 6px;background:#fff url(../images/.gif) no-repeat 100% -25px; display:block;border-bottom:solid 1px #fff;}


ul.recent               {margin-top:10px;}
ul.recent li            {display:block; clear:both;  border-bottom:1px dashed #e0e0e0; padding:10px 0;}
ul.recent li a           {display:inline; font-weight:bold;}
ul.recent li a:hover      {text-decoration:none}

.minheight01			{min-height:120px;}
*html .minheight01	    {height:120px;}

.attention1	{ background:#FFFFCC url(../images/attention.gif) left no-repeat; color:#C60000; padding-left:80px;}
div.messageBox{
background-color:#FFFFCC;
background-position:20px 14px;
background-repeat:no-repeat;
/*border:1px solid #FFCC00;*/border-bottom:2px solid #FE8D05; border-top:2px solid #FE8D05;
font-size:1em;
margin:0pt 5pt 10px;
min-height:48px;
padding:12px 40px 0pt 12px;
width:auto;}

ul.errmsg      {list-style-type:none; padding-left:45px;}
ul.errmsg li       {clear:both; font-size:12px;}



